I stayed at the Park Tower, a Luxury Collection Hotel in 2011 and it was great. Unfortunately, 12 years later, the hotel is really rundown, poorly kept and my corner suite was terrible. I went to Buenos Aires to attend the Panamerican Congress of Ophthalmology and stayed 4 nights, March 16-20, 2023. Despite being Platinum, I could not check in to a room upon arrival to the hotel at 12:30 pm. So we went to the pool, but it was at the Sheraton Hotel next door. The pool chairs were very dirty looking and every single chair was stained; everything at the pool looked dirty, paint was peeling off surrounding walls and accessories were rusted. My room was extremely hot as the air conditioning did not work. When I asked someone to check the air conditioning, the person who came said to close the curtains if I wanted the room to cool off. What is the point of paying for a corner suite with windows on 2 sides if I have to keep the black out curtains closed? The shower flooded the bathroom floor and the person who came to check said it was fine. The shower flooded the bathroom floor daily. Housekeeping had to be called to make up the room every day in late afternoon. Towels were removed but not replaced in the same numbers. I had to use extra towels to dry the bathroom floor daily. The washcloths were also not replaced after the first day. There was a coffee machine but the coffee pods were not replaced. There was no turn down service. I paid for club access and found out that the club was at the Sheraton next door and only open from 2 pm to 8 pm, so no breakfast! The quality of the food was poor. There was one restaurant in the Park Tower hotel that served breakfast which was pretty good. Despite the elevator button indicating “Business Center” on the second floor of Park Tower Hotel, there is no Business Center at Park Tower - it is also at the Sheraton next door. Service is generally poor across the board - the concierge did not know whether the restaurant served lunch! He also would not call me a taxi to go to the Rural Convention Center when I asked. I am not sure why they are there if they don’t provide concierge services. I love Marriott Hotels and this hotel definitely does not meet the expectations or requirements of a Marriott Hotel. It is badly in need of renovations, repairs and personnel who are willing to provide good service. 725 Continental Hotel is in a central position, short walk one way to Plaza de la Republica, with Obelisco, and a short walk the other way to Plaza de Mayo.A stop for the open top bus tours is on the other side of the street. Hailing a taxi is easy on the roadside but reception ordered a taxi without charge. The hotel has no car park, but there is paid-parking nearby. This art deco building is in a street of such buildings making for a scenic cityscape, both from the street and roof top terrace, where there is a bar and small pool. Sunset drinks were enjoyed on the roof. Room and ensuite was large and everywhere was clean. Reception directed us to 2 double rooms before finding the twin we had booked, which was an unwanted inconvenience after a long journey. There was a paid mini bar but no kettle in the room. View was across to the buildings the other side of the street. Air conditioning worked well. The lifts are slow and the wait was tiresome, but fortunately we could use the stairs from our room on a lower floor. Breakfast is served on the first floor, and there is a bar and restaurant on the ground floor, which we did not use. There are tango shows and many restaurants within a short walk of the hotel. Breakfast buffet was adequate with omelettes cooked to order. Window tables have picturesque street views. Facilities give the five star rating, but 725 Continental Hotel is more comfortable than luxurious. Location and service on offer made it good value.
